IP查询
查询
你查询的IP:[120.188.17.230] 地理位置:印度尼西亚
最新查询
118.64.41.98
123.253.22.62
121.40.33.79
222.16.95.196
118.112.93.180
125.96.197.191
121.16.240.125
121.60.209.192
161.207.64.108
120.188.17.230
119.27.160.110
122.248.48.32
203.196.254.190
202.173.8.160
219.82.87.198
221.172.112.208
61.8.160.160
222.64.221.143
202.127.12.175
221.13.98.214
114.68.11.164
117.74.64.62
202.92.116.172
116.52.148.131
116.8.83.66
202.143.16.63
202.14.235.127
118.80.9.79
119.30.48.169
119.59.128.36
118.102.16.252